Stabilized Platan Wood

Raffir stabilized platan wood is a strong choice for handles and inlays. We cut platan wood in two different directions: XC and YC. It has fine contrast lines in the XC direction. Meanwhile, it has a unique and very different snakeskin texture in the YC direction. Both of these cutting directions reveals wonderful grain patterns. The stabilization process also gives extra contrast to the grain pattern. Therefore, platan wood and dyed stabilization is a perfect match. All of our platan wood is forested in Europe under high quality standards.

Variations and properties

Stabilized platan has the unique grain structure of the raw wood. Meanwhile, it obtains mechanical advantages from the strong resin compound. Stabilization also gives the wood an extra 3D depth. This effect is very clear after polishing. We stabilize it in five colors: black, blue, purple, red and green. Raffir stabilized wood has high durability. It also obtains a high gloss finish after polishing. It absorbs very little water and has low swelling and shrinkage at different humidities. The material has a smooth surface and needs no other finishing than fine sanding and polishing.

Available Dimensions

Our standard handle blocks are 120*40*25mm, while handle scales are 120*40*8mm. Custom dimensions are also available for other purposes. The maximum custom size is the size of our finished raw blocks. Our standard raw blocks are up to 300*135*45mm. However, we can stabilize up to 300*200*60mm.
